HTML入门与进阶教程:超文本标记语言解析

5星 · 超过95%的资源 需积分: 10 98 下载量 5 浏览量 更新于2024-07-30 3 收藏 1.15MB PPT 举报
“html教程PPT” HTML(HyperText Markup Language)是用于创建网页的标准标记语言。这个教程适合初学者和进阶者学习HTML编程。HTML文件由一系列元素组成,这些元素以开始标记和结束标记的形式成对出现。文档通常包含三个主要部分:`<html>`(整个文档的根元素)、`<head>`(存储元数据,如标题)和`<body>`(网页的实际内容)。 1. HTML文档编写方式: - 手工直接编写:使用简单的文本编辑器,如记事本,保存为`.htm`或`.html`格式。 - 可视化HTML编辑器:例如Frontpage和Dreamweaver,提供图形界面来简化编码过程。 - 动态生成:由Web服务器根据用户请求实时生成。 2. 网页文件命名规则: - 文件扩展名通常是`.htm`或`.html`。 - 不允许空格,可以用下划线`_`替代。 - 只能包含英文和数字,不能有特殊字符,如&。 - 文件名区分大小写。 - 首页文件名通常设为`index.htm`或`index.html`。 3. HTML文件结构: - `<html>`:整个文档的容器。 - `<head>`:包含文档元数据,如标题和样式表链接。 - `<title>`:定义网页的标题,显示在浏览器标签上。 - `<meta>`:提供关于文档的元信息,如字符编码。 - `<body>`:网页的主体内容区域,所有可见内容都放在这里。 - `<p>`:段落元素,可以通过属性`align`设置对齐方式,如`<p align="center">`使内容居中。 4. HTML元素属性: - 元素可以有属性,属性指定元素的附加信息。 - 属性写在元素的开始标记内,与元素名称间用空格分隔。 - 属性值用双引号包围,如`<p align="center">`。 举例: ```html <!DOCTYPE html> <html> <head> <title>示例网页</title> </head> <body> <h1>欢迎来到示例网页</h1> <p align="justify">这是一个使用HTML创建的示例网页,你可以在这里学习如何布局和格式化内容。</p> </body> </html> ``` 在这个例子中,`<h1>`定义了一个一级标题,而`<p>`元素的`align="justify"`属性使得文本左右对齐。 通过深入学习HTML,你将掌握如何创建结构化的网页,包括文本、图像、链接、表格、列表、表单等各种元素,以及如何使用CSS来添加样式和JavaScript来实现交互性。随着技术的发展,现代HTML(如HTML5)引入了更多新特性,如多媒体支持、离线存储和更强大的表单控件,使得网页设计和开发更为强大和灵活。